The labour day long weekend is traditionally a weekend to walk to MUMC Hut (See the MUMC Hut tab under "About Us") on Mt Feathertop and undertake some maintenance tasks (Nothing Strenuous I promise, and you’re also welcome to come for a great weekend hike and not do any maintenance). This trip is open to anyone who wants to try out over night hiking. We will drive up Friday night after uni/work and there will be options to return Sunday night as the Monday is not a university holiday or return Monday for those who have it off.


MUMC hut was built on Mt Feathertop in 1966, they hiked in everything to build it, luckily now we're only hiking in maintenance materials. There are two walks we can chose from, both good for first hikes, one up Bungalow Spur from Harrietville, a gentle but consistent up hill or undulating along the razorback from Mt Hotham, one of the best walks in Victoria. Both are suitable for members new to hiking and most of the required gear can be hired from the club (sleeping bag, stove etc.) you will need warm clothes (the mountains can be cold even in February and March) and good walking shoes (Sneakers in good condition are ok for these walks but not ideal).


At the hut there will be ample opportunity for some R+R and to summit Mt Feathertop. I will update with maintenance work later or discuss at the trip meeting. For those new to the club please note the Tuesday meeting before this trip is compulsory to attend to organise logistics gear etc.
